*FREE EVENT* Water Pool-ooza at the Waste Recovery Resource Facility (WRRF)! is a FREE, family event designed to introduce 4th-12th grade students to the journey of their drinking water, careers in water, conservation efforts, and how to become a water champion. For the best experience, arrive at the Leslie E. Tassell MTEC Building, 22 Godfrey S.W., for hands-on learning stations and activities, and then take the free shuttle two minutes down the road to the WRRF to take a tour of the plant, then ride the shuttle back.
Take a behind‑the‑scenes journey through our wastewater facility and follow used water as it’s transformed back into clean water! From the moment it arrives through pipes underground to the hardworking microbes that help clean it, you’ll see every step of the process. Learn how wastewater becomes safe to return to nature and discover the science and careers that keep our water systems flowing.
A guided tour will follow the path of water throughout the City of Grand Rapids WRRF and engage in hands-on activities led by water professionals, City staff, and community partners.
By participating in Water Pool-ooza at the WRRF attendees will learn about the importance of our natural water resources and begin to understand their role as water champions within our community.
